Detailed Explanation
Percentages represent parts per hundred. The word "percent" comes from the Latin "per centum," meaning "by the hundred." So, when we say 10 percent, we mean 10 out of every 100 parts. To find 10 percent of any number, you multiply that number by 0.10 (which is the decimal equivalent of 10%).
For example, 10 percent of 600 can be calculated as: $ 600 \times 0.10 = 60 $
This means that 10 percent of 600 is 60. This calculation is straightforward, but understanding the concept behind it is crucial for more complex applications.
Step-by-Step Calculation
Let's break down the process of finding 10 percent of 600 into clear steps:
- Understand the percentage: 10 percent means 10 out of 100, or 0.10 in decimal form.
- Multiply the number by the decimal: Take the number 600 and multiply it by 0.10.
- Calculate the result: $ 600 \times 0.10 = 60 $.
This method works for any percentage calculation. For instance, if you wanted to find 20 percent of 600, you would multiply 600 by 0.20, resulting in 120.

Common Mistakes or Misunderstandings
While calculating percentages is straightforward, there are common pitfalls to avoid:
- Confusing Percentages with Decimals: Remember that 10 percent is 0.10, not 10. Multiplying by 10 would give you 6000, which is incorrect.
- Misplacing the Decimal Point: Ensure you move the decimal point correctly when converting percentages to decimals.
- Forgetting to Multiply: Some might add the percentage instead of multiplying, leading to incorrect results.
By being aware of these mistakes, you can ensure accurate calculations.
FAQs
Q: How do I calculate 10 percent of any number? A: Multiply the number by 0.10. For example, 10 percent of 500 is $ 500 \times 0.10 = 50 $.
Q: Why is 10 percent of 600 equal to 60? A: Because 10 percent is one-tenth, and one-tenth of 600 is 60.
Q: Can I use a calculator to find 10 percent of 600? A: Yes, simply enter 600, multiply by 0.10, and the result will be 60.
Q: Is there a quick way to find 10 percent without a calculator? A: Yes, move the decimal point one place to the left. For 600, moving the decimal gives 60.
